Cost
Homeowners can anticipate spending between $300 and $880 for window glass replacement, depending on the size of the windows replacements near me, the type of tint, size, and features. Triple-paned windows that are energy efficient are the most expensive to replace.
Materials, labor and any installation costs are included in the typical costs. A professional with experience will provide an exact breakdown of the work and costs. This includes the removal of old windows and installing new windows and the sealing of the frame.
If your windows are old and in poor condition, replacing them may be a smart decision. They will not only provide your home a better appearance, but also cut down on outside noise and block UV radiation. They also improve security, curb appeal, and energy efficiency. Installing energy efficient windows could also allow homeowners to claim an additional 30% credit.
The replacement of a single typical window pane is priced between $100 and $500. If the entire frame is damaged, it's generally more cost-effective to replace the entire window.
Glaziers or window professionals charge between $50 to $75 per hour to replace windows. The cost can quickly add up when your window is big or has complicated fittings. This is why it is often a good idea to hire an experienced company that can handle the entire project and offers a warranty.
You can save money by preserving the frame and muntins but a window that has cracks larger than an inch is not worth saving. The reason for this is that the crack will only get worse over time and may cause water leakage.
Another method to reduce the cost of window glass replacement is to opt for tinted or insulated glass. This will reduce the amount of heat that enters and leaving your home, thus lowering your heating and cooling bills. You can pick tinted glasses of a variety of colors, styles and qualities. You can also purchase UV film to reduce the amount UV rays that pass through the window.
Energy Efficiency
It may seem like a simple task to replace a broken piece of glass, however there are instances when it is more economical to replace the whole window. This option gives you the opportunity to upgrade to a more energy efficient window glass type, which can save you money on your utility bills and improve the comfort of your home.
The most obvious reason to replace a whole window is when the glass panes have broken or cracked and are no longer protecting your home from weather conditions. It's also a great time to upgrade your home's security and security by replacing your windows.
If you are replacing a window the best choice is to select an insulated glass type that can stop heat transfer and air leaks. This will help keep your home warm in both hot and cold temperatures, while also reducing your energy bills.
Insulated window glass typically consists of three or two panes sandwiched together with an area between. The space between the panes is filled with nonreactive gases like argon or krypton. This adds an extra layer of insulation that prevents heat transfer from inside to the outside of your home.
This kind of window is more costly than traditional single-pane glass, but the investment is amortized over time due to lower energy costs. The choice of an insulated glass windows can save you up to 30% on your energy bill, based on the type of window you choose and the size of your home.

Safety
If normal glass breaks it will break into sharp jagged shards that pose a danger to anyone in the vicinity. Millions of people are hurt by broken glass every year in both commercial and residential situations, and the consequences can be serious. The severity of injuries can range from abrasions and cuts to blood loss and shock, infection and fractured tendons or arteries or eye injuries, and even Amputations. It is recommended to have the fracture repaired as soon as you can, regardless of its extent.
Window cracks that aren't immediately treated can result in moisture infiltration between the window panes. This can cause windows to appear cloudy and are difficult to clean. Moisture infiltration can cause seal failure that could increase energy costs and create drafts.
The best method to avoid such problems is to hire an expert to install your replacement windows glasses replacement. You may make mistakes that compromise the safety, security and efficiency of your home if you try to do it yourself.
In addition, to ensure that the new window pane is installed correctly The installation process should include a thorough cleaning of the opening and frame. Then, apply a glaze compound to the L-shaped grooves in the frame to aid in securing the new pane. Glazier points should be inserted every 10 inches for additional support, and a final coat of glazing compound should be applied to the window's surface.
Wearing gloves that are thick and safety glasses is important before you begin the window replacement. It's also a good idea to make sure someone is there to catch any large pieces that fall during the replacement process. After the glass is removed, it's vital to recycle it properly to ensure that it does not end up in the environment and cause further harm.
Curb Appeal
Window replacement is a way to improve the efficiency of energy use, curb appeal, and durability in a home. It is essential to consider the aesthetic qualities of the new windows prior to making a final decision. A professional window installer can assist you in selecting windows for your home that are in keeping with your personal style and blend with the architectural design of your home.
If you reside in an older home it is possible to play around with patterns stained, frosted, or frosted glass. These types of windows can add a sense of opulence which will instantly increase the curb appeal of your home. They are also an excellent choice for homes that have architectural features which can benefit from a visual accent. Geometric shapes such as circles and pentagons, or the octagons and octagons could create an unique look.
Another way to increase the curb appeal of your home is by using decorative hardware and trim. These elements can be used to highlight specific areas of your windows or create an even style for the entire frame. These elements can be utilized in conjunction with other home improvement projects like a fresh coat of paint or a door to give an area a stand out.
The choice of the best window for your home isn't only an investment in its performance and appearance however, it can also increase the value of your home. Studies have shown that certain home improvement projects can increase the perceived value of a property by 5 to 10 percent.
It's important to remember that not all replacement windows are created equal. Some can have a negative impact on the appearance of your home. For instance, certain windows may have cheap flat plastic window muntins, which change the original window style from two-over-two to square four-over-four windows. It's also important to avoid putting in a replacement window that is too big or small for the space.
